• AWS has a shitton of in-house “Graviton” ARM stuff available and the ARM server chips from Ampere are popping up in more and more places as well. Most Linux servery distros have ARM images available now, and most software builds without major changes. It’s a slow transition but it’s already happening.

    • Yeah and ARM servers are cheap. You can often get twice the processor cores and memory for the same price.

      That doesn’t always map to twice the performance, though some benchmarks would suggest it could for certain applications.
